    Benfica Climb Where They Stand Now

    Sport Lisboa e Benfica, commonly known as Benfica, stands as one of Portugal’s most illustrious football clubs. With a rich history and a legacy of success, the club consistently competes at the highest levels both domestically and in European competitions. This article delves into Benfica’s current standings across various competitions, highlighting their performances, key players, and prospects.

    Domestic Performance: Liga Portugal Betclic

    As of the latest updates, Benfica holds a prominent position in the Liga Portugal Betclic standings. After 22 matches, the team’s record includes 16 victories, 2 draws, and 4 losses. This performance has garnered them a total of 50 points, placing them in second position, just behind Sporting CP, who leads with 52 points. Benfica’s goal difference stands at +32, having scored 50 goals and conceded 18.

    Recent Matches and Form

    In their recent league fixtures, Benfica has demonstrated commendable form. The team secured a 3-1 victory against Estoril, showcasing their attacking prowess. However, they faced a setback with a 0-2 loss to Porto, a match that highlighted areas needing improvement. Overall, their recent form reflects a team capable of bouncing back and maintaining pressure on league leaders.

    European Campaign: UEFA Champions League

    Benfica’s journey in the UEFA Champions League has been noteworthy. They concluded the league phase in 16th position, amassing 13 points. This placement secured them a spot in the playoffs, where they are set to face AS Monaco. A pivotal match in their campaign was the 2-0 victory against Juventus, with goals from Vangelis Pavlidis and Orkun Kökçü, underscoring their competitive edge on the European stage.

    Key Players and Contributions

    Several players have been instrumental in Benfica’s performances this season:

    Vangelis Pavlidis: The forward has been in stellar form, netting 17 goals this season, including seven in the Champions League. His ability to find the back of the net consistently makes him a crucial asset for the team.
     

    Ángel Di María: Despite recent injury setbacks, Di María’s experience and skill have been invaluable. His absence in crucial matches, such as the upcoming Champions League tie against Barcelona, is a significant concern for the team.

    Orkun Kökçü and Florentino: These midfield maestros have provided stability and creativity, orchestrating play and linking defense with attack effectively.

    Defensive Solidity

    The defensive duo of Antonio Silva and Álvaro Carreras has been pivotal in maintaining Benfica’s defensive strength. Their coordination and resilience have contributed to the team’s impressive record of conceding only 18 goals in the league so far.

    Challenges and Depth Concerns

    While Benfica boasts a strong starting lineup, depth remains a concern. The team has relied heavily on a core group of players, with only 13 individuals accumulating over 1,000 minutes of play. This lack of rotational options could pose challenges, especially when facing teams with deeper squads in both domestic and European competitions.

    Youth Development and Future Prospects

    Benfica’s commitment to nurturing young talent is evident through their extensive network of international academies. This approach allows them to identify and develop players in their local environments before integrating them into the main squad. This strategy has positioned Benfica as a leading talent factory in Europe, producing players who are both technically proficient and tactically astute.
